ChemPlusChem, 78(3), 218-221. | Series/Report no.: | ChemPlusChem | Abstract: | Yolk–shell spheres as nanoreactors: Single-crystalline LiMn2O4 and LiMn1.5Ni0.5O4 nanocrystals have been prepared by using yolk–shell spheres as nanoreactors to confine the size of the nanocrystals to a range of 14–19 nm (see scheme). These nanocrystals were subsequently employed as cathode materials and showed high lithium-ion storage capacities and stable charge–discharge cycling, especially at high current densities. | URI: | https://hdl.handle.net/10356/99755 http://hdl.handle.net/10220/17637 |
